Job summary

A governmental agency is looking for an experienced professional to analyze agricultural data and provide advisory services to farmers. The role includes conducting research, maintaining records, and sharing information through presentations. The ideal candidate will have a doctorate and extensive experience in agribusiness, with excellent communication skills. This position involves frequent travel and offers health benefits, making it critical in helping Canada achieve its environmental targets.
